Output 3087bc2124d3debdcb7291f8289ff761b1581dd3cdfc6d782c86da468ae42768:1

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d515612fbfb1d2b2df46533e229560959db5d940 OP_EQUAL
address
3M7hTtP8GAtfmYYRF2TBf66rv8x8Uuer6r
transaction
3087bc2124d3debdcb7291f8289ff761b1581dd3cdfc6d782c86da468ae42768
spent
true